2. MP3 conversion

MP3 conversion is a vital step in the process of obtaining audio files from online video platforms. Following the extraction of audio, typically in a format like AAC or Opus, it is the conversion to the MP3 format that makes the audio compatible with a wider range of devices and software.

  • Technical Standards

    MP3, or MPEG-1 Audio Layer III, is a widely accepted audio coding format using lossy data compression. This reduces file size by discarding audio data considered inaudible to most listeners. The conversion process involves re-encoding the extracted audio into the MP3 format, adhering to specific technical parameters such as bitrate and sampling rate. These parameters directly affect the audio quality and file size. For example, a higher bitrate MP3 file will generally result in better audio fidelity but will also occupy more storage space.

  • Software and Algorithms

    MP3 conversion relies on algorithms and software specifically designed for audio encoding. These tools, ranging from open-source libraries to commercial applications, implement the MP3 encoding process, often providing users with configurable options for controlling the output quality and file size. The algorithms used determine the efficiency and accuracy of the compression, influencing the perceptual quality of the converted audio. An example would be the LAME encoder, commonly used for its high-quality MP3 output.

  • Compatibility and Accessibility

    The primary reason for converting extracted audio to MP3 is its widespread compatibility. Most digital audio players, smartphones, and computer operating systems natively support the MP3 format. This ensures that the audio file obtained through the “you tube to mp 3 download” process can be played on a multitude of devices without requiring specialized software or codecs. The universality of MP3 contributes significantly to its enduring popularity as an audio format.

  • Quality vs. File Size Trade-off

    MP3 conversion necessitates a trade-off between audio quality and file size. Lower bitrates result in smaller files, facilitating easier storage and transmission, but at the expense of audio fidelity. Conversely, higher bitrates yield better audio quality but increase the file size. Users involved in the “you tube to mp 3 download” process must consider this trade-off when selecting the appropriate bitrate for their MP3 conversions. The choice should align with the intended use case and the available storage capacity of the playback device.

In summary, MP3 conversion is an essential step in the process, allowing for audio content to be accessed universally, offering flexibility across devices and platforms. Understanding the technical parameters, algorithms, and the necessary balance between quality and file size allows users to optimize their audio acquisition process.

3. Copyright infringement

The activity of obtaining MP3 files from online video platforms, often referred to informally, carries significant implications regarding copyright infringement. A primary function of copyright law is to protect the rights of content creators, including musicians, filmmakers, and other artists. Copyright grants exclusive control over the reproduction, distribution, and modification of their work. Extracting audio from a video without explicit permission from the copyright holder often constitutes a violation of these rights. The act of downloading an MP3 file from a video containing copyrighted music, for example, without purchasing the music or having legal authorization, is a direct infringement. This unauthorized reproduction undermines the economic interests of the copyright owner, who is entitled to receive compensation for the use of their creative work.

The widespread availability of online video-to-MP3 conversion services has inadvertently facilitated copyright infringement on a large scale. Many users may be unaware of the legal ramifications of their actions, assuming that because a video is publicly accessible online, they are free to extract and download its audio. This misconception is not legally sound. The public availability of a video does not negate the underlying copyright protections afforded to its content. Consider the case of a copyrighted lecture series uploaded to an online platform. Even though the lectures are available for viewing, extracting the audio for personal use without permission remains a copyright violation. Enforcement of copyright law in the digital realm presents considerable challenges, given the sheer volume of online content and the ease with which it can be copied and distributed.

8. Data security

Data security represents a critical concern when considering the practices surrounding audio extraction from online video platforms. This security focus extends to the safeguarding of personal information, prevention of malware infections, and maintenance of system integrity during and after engaging in processes to obtain MP3 files. Neglecting data security measures can lead to significant risks, compromising user privacy and system stability.

  • Malware Distribution

    Services offering audio extraction functionalities frequently serve as vectors for malware distribution. Unreputable websites may bundle malicious software with the downloaded MP3 file or redirect users to compromised websites. For example, a user attempting to acquire an MP3 file may inadvertently download a Trojan horse, which could then steal sensitive data or compromise system security. Vigilance in selecting reputable service providers and employing robust antivirus software is crucial in mitigating this threat.

  • Data Harvesting Practices

    Some platforms collect user data without explicit consent or transparency. These practices may involve tracking browsing activity, capturing IP addresses, or even accessing personal information stored on the user’s device. This data can be used for targeted advertising, sold to third parties, or potentially exploited for malicious purposes. A user accessing a free MP3 conversion site may be unaware that their browsing history is being tracked and sold to advertising networks. Reviewing privacy policies and using privacy-enhancing tools can help mitigate these risks.

  • Phishing and Social Engineering

    Websites associated with offer lucrative benefits for doing so but, they can also lead to phishing attacks or social engineering schemes. Attackers may create convincing fake websites designed to mimic legitimate services, tricking users into entering their login credentials or other sensitive information. A user seeking a free MP3 download may be lured to a fake website that prompts them to enter their email address and password, which the attackers can then use to compromise their online accounts. Skepticism and verifying the authenticity of websites are essential defenses against these attacks.

  • Compromised Download Servers

    Even seemingly reputable service providers are vulnerable to security breaches that can compromise their download servers. If a server is compromised, malicious actors could inject malware into the downloaded MP3 files, infecting users who download them. A user downloading an MP3 file from a popular conversion website may unknowingly receive a file containing a virus that exploits a vulnerability in their operating system. Regularly updating software and employing intrusion detection systems can help minimize the risk of server-side compromises.

Question 1: Is it legal to download MP3 files from online video platforms?

The legality depends on copyright ownership and permissions. Downloading copyrighted material without the copyright holder’s consent is generally illegal. Fair use exceptions may exist for limited purposes such as criticism, commentary, news reporting, teaching, scholarship, or research.

Question 2: Are online audio extraction services safe to use?

The security of such services varies. Some may bundle malware or collect user data without consent. Employing reputable antivirus software and scrutinizing website security indicators is advisable.

Question 3: Does extracting audio from online videos violate copyright laws?

Extracting audio from copyrighted videos without authorization typically infringes on the copyright holder’s rights. Exceptions may apply under specific fair use provisions or if the content is licensed for such use.

Question 4: How does the quality of the source video affect the quality of the extracted MP3 file?

The quality of the source video has a direct bearing on the quality of the extracted audio. Higher-quality source material generally yields a better MP3 output. The conversion process may introduce further quality degradation.

Question 5: What are the alternatives to using online audio extraction services?

Legitimate alternatives include purchasing the music through online music stores, subscribing to streaming services, or obtaining permission from the copyright holder to extract the audio.

Question 6: Are there any legal consequences for downloading copyrighted audio from online video platforms?

Legal consequences for unauthorized downloading can range from cease-and-desist letters to lawsuits for copyright infringement, potentially resulting in monetary damages and legal fees.
